HVAC Maintenance Technician - 1111 Main at the Skyline Collection

Copaken Brooks, LLC is a full-service commercial real estate firm headquartered in Kansas City and serving the Midwest. The HVAC Maintenance Engineer will perform various inspections and follow up on deficiencies to improve and maintain the physical appearance and mechanical integrity of the property, while promoting positive tenant and customer relations.

Responsibilities

Consistent maintenance and resolution of facility functions – such as alarms, power (outages), water damage and usage, temperature control, plumbing, changing lights/ballasts, minor repairs and related property updates
Maintenance and repair of commercial HVAC, refrigeration, electrical, plumbing, fire sprinkler and both pneumatic and electronic building control system management and compliance
Respond to tenant calls, emergency and maintenance issues immediately, notifying the appropriate party and resolving such issues in a timely and accurate manner
Perform HVAC installation, trouble shooting and preventative maintenance, with notice to system servicing and working condition

Required

Minimum (3) three years recent work experience in commercial office environment; on call for at least (1) one of the three years
Working knowledge of HVAC equipment
Working knowledge of Chillers
Working knowledge of Air Compressors
Working knowledge of Air Handlers
Working knowledge of Cooling Towers
Working knowledge of Pumps and Motors
Working knowledge of Fan Coil Units
Working knowledge of Piping and Plumbing
Working knowledge of Exhaust Fans
Working knowledge of Fire Systems
Working knowledge of Generators and Switchgears
Electrical, plumbing and general carpentry EMS and HVAC experience a plus
High school diploma, an Associate Degree OR HVAC/Maintenance Engineer program certification
Universal CFC license – obtained within the first year of employment
Valid driver's license and good driving record
Basic computer knowledge required
Willing and able to stand and walk for extensive periods of time
Ability to lift up to 50 pounds (ladders, boxes, )
Working in all weather conditions, stressful situations and construction environments
Willing to be on-call for emergency situations as well as overtime flexibility, as needed
Assess/manage project legal, building, construction, safety, and other AHJ regulation compliance
Identify/implement internal operations improvement opportunities (processes, reports)
